流动注射法分析江河水中的COD 被引量:5

Determination of COD on River by Flow Injection Analysis

摘要 采用流动注射酸性高锰酸钾法测定江河水中的COD,对实验条件进行优化,改变氧化液浓度、泵管内径、分析时间等条件,可以更好地提高灵敏度和准确度,本方法适于现场实时监测,具备了快速、连续、自动、精密度好、线性范围宽等特点。线性范围为0.5~60.0mg·L^-1,回收率在95.3~109.7%之间。 Determination COD with potassium permanganate by Flow injection analysis and optimize experimental conditions were studied which include the dosage of the oxidation solution, tube diameter, analytical time, etc. his method which has many characteristics, such as rapid, successive, automatic, precision, anti-jamming, wide line range and so on can be used to measure COD locally on time. The calibration graph was linear within 0. 5-60.0 mg · L^-1, and the recoveries of river samples were between 91.17% and 103. 5%.
